In the reporting, whats a unique view?

We have been using Webtrends Optimize for a while now. Does anyone know what the difference is between a unique view and all views? Or Unique Conversions and All conversions. Whats the best one to measure our conversion rates with?

To summarise this for you, Unique Views is a metric to look at each individual visitor across all of their sessions within the duration of a test project. Multiple visits to the test page are counted once for the test duration. Unique conversions operates similarly. Multiple conversions are only counted the once for the test project duration. Total Views/Total Conversions count ALL page views and ALL conversions. An easy way to look at this is by looking at a purchase, if a user comes on to your website 3 times before purchasing this would appear as 3 views and only 1 conversion when looking in Total Views/Total Conversions. If you were to look at Unique Views/Unique Conversions, then you would see this as 1 view and 1 conversion. In terms of the "best" method to use, it really depends on your site traffic and success criteria. For example, if you goal is customer acquisition related, then Unique visitors & Unique conversions will serve you best. If your site has a lot of returning visits and you are more interested in increasing the number of times a visitor converts in a time period, then Unique Visitors and All conversions will be more meaningful.
